Cube representation

The representation we use here is a (1, 54) vector, each value representing the color of a sticker.
The 6 are listed in this order: Front Top Back Bottom Right Left
Each face contains 9 values (6 * 9 = 54)
Each value is an integer between 0 and 5 representing the color of the sticker:
COLORS = {
0: 'Green',
1: 'White',
2: 'Blue',
3: 'Yellow',
4: 'Red',
5: 'Orange'
}

The 'standard' position of the solved cube will be represented with the white face on top\


Cube actions

Actions are represented with (54, 54) permutation matrices.
state * action -> new_state
(1, 54) * (54, 54) -> (1, 54)\

The permutation matrices for all actions are obtained from the 3 basic permutation matrices representing the actions [r], [u], and R.
